𝗛𝗲𝗮𝗹𝘁𝗵 𝗶𝗻 𝗔𝗰𝘁𝗶𝗼𝗻: 𝗔𝗱𝘃𝗮𝗻𝗰𝗶𝗻𝗴 𝗧𝗕 𝗣𝗿𝗲𝘃𝗲𝗻𝘁𝗶𝗼𝗻 𝗶𝗻 𝘁𝗵𝗲 𝗡𝗮𝘁𝗶𝗼𝗻𝗮𝗹 𝗖𝗮𝗽𝗶𝘁𝗮𝗹 𝗥𝗲𝗴𝗶𝗼𝗻

From 𝗔𝘂𝗴𝘂𝘀𝘁 𝟭𝟮–𝟭𝟰, 𝟮𝟬𝟮𝟲, frontline healthcare workers from Local Government Units (LGUs) across the 𝗡𝗮𝘁𝗶𝗼𝗻𝗮𝗹 𝗖𝗮𝗽𝗶𝘁𝗮𝗹 𝗥𝗲𝗴𝗶𝗼𝗻 (𝗡𝗖𝗥) convened at 𝗕𝗿𝗲𝗻𝘁𝘄𝗼𝗼𝗱 𝗦𝘂𝗶𝘁𝗲𝘀, 𝗤𝘂𝗲𝘇𝗼𝗻 𝗖𝗶𝘁𝘆, for the 𝗦𝘁𝗿𝗲𝗻𝗴𝘁𝗵𝗲𝗻𝗶𝗻𝗴 𝗧𝗕 𝗣𝗿𝗲𝘃𝗲𝗻𝘁𝗶𝗼𝗻 𝗦𝗲𝗿𝘃𝗶𝗰𝗲𝘀: 𝗖𝗮𝗽𝗮𝗰𝗶𝘁𝘆 𝗕𝘂𝗶𝗹𝗱𝗶𝗻𝗴 𝗼𝗳 𝗛𝗲𝗮𝗹𝘁𝗵𝗰𝗮𝗿𝗲 𝗪𝗼𝗿𝗸𝗲𝗿𝘀 𝗼𝗻 𝗖𝗼𝗻𝘁𝗮𝗰𝘁 𝗜𝗻𝘃𝗲𝘀𝘁𝗶𝗴𝗮𝘁𝗶𝗼𝗻, 𝗧𝗕 𝗣𝗿𝗲𝘃𝗲𝗻𝘁𝗶𝘃𝗲 𝗧𝗿𝗲𝗮𝘁𝗺𝗲𝗻𝘁 (𝗖𝗜-𝗧𝗣𝗧), 𝗮𝗻𝗱 𝗧𝘂𝗯𝗲𝗿𝗰𝘂𝗹𝗶𝗻 𝗦𝗸𝗶𝗻 𝗧𝗲𝘀𝘁𝗶𝗻𝗴 (𝗧𝗦𝗧).

The capacity-building activity enhanced the knowledge and competencies of doctors, nurses, and midwives in delivering quality TB prevention services. Through lectures, video presentations, actual demonstrations and return demonstrations, case discussions, and hands-on exercises, participants strengthened their skills in contact investigation, TB infection prevention and control, Tuberculin Skin Testing (TST), and the implementation of TB Preventive Treatment (TPT). The training was guided by the DOH National Tuberculosis Control Program (NTP) guidelines and best practices in screening, documentation, and service delivery.

The activity was implemented through the collaboration of the 𝗗𝗲𝗽𝗮𝗿𝘁𝗺𝗲𝗻𝘁 𝗼𝗳 𝗛𝗲𝗮𝗹𝘁𝗵 – 𝗠𝗲𝘁𝗿𝗼 𝗠𝗮𝗻𝗶𝗹𝗮 𝗖𝗲𝗻𝘁𝗲𝗿 𝗳𝗼𝗿 𝗛𝗲𝗮𝗹𝘁𝗵 𝗗𝗲𝘃𝗲𝗹𝗼𝗽𝗺𝗲𝗻𝘁 (𝗗𝗢𝗛–𝗠𝗠𝗖𝗛𝗗), 𝗟𝗼𝗰𝗮𝗹 𝗚𝗼𝘃𝗲𝗿𝗻𝗺𝗲𝗻𝘁 𝗨𝗻𝗶𝘁𝘀 𝗮𝗰𝗿𝗼𝘀𝘀 𝗡𝗖𝗥, and 𝗖𝘂𝗹𝗶𝗼𝗻 𝗙𝗼𝘂𝗻𝗱𝗮𝘁𝗶𝗼𝗻, 𝗜𝗻𝗰., providing technical and implementation support to strengthen local capacity for TB prevention and contact investigation.

By empowering healthcare workers with updated knowledge and practical skills, this initiative reinforces the collective commitment to expanding access to quality TB preventive services and bringing the country closer to the goal of a TB-free Philippines.
